In 2019, a new GSK facility started production in Parma, Italy.The initial requirement was to design and build a pharmaceutical facility in 15 months that would usually have taken closer to three years to complete, in order to maintain supply of a life-saving treatment for people with HIV.We achieved this mould-breaking pharmaceutical facility by, as described, investing significant time and focus in modelling the problem before going anywhere near construction..

The Parma project is an evidenced demonstration that our Design to Value approach made it possible to design, construct and commission a new pharmaceutical manufacturing facility in record time without increasing budgets or compromising on any aspect of quality.. Joining Bryden Wood in 2015 after several years as a structural engineer and in the FinTech (Finance/Technology) sector, Tanya’s focus was initially to strengthen Bryden Wood’s front end capability, incorporating an agile approach to project management, while also leveraging her background in engineering.. Tanya’s driver is always that projects follow the principles of.Design to Value.

This ensures that both the projects undertaken, and solutions developed, are right for the client and deliver maximum value.Incremental, iterative design, constant close collaboration with stakeholders and openness to change are key to this.. Tanya works closely with stakeholders to identify the business need and value drivers for projects, and to define their overall scope.
